| 正面铭文 | VITTORIO EMANUELE III RE D'ITALIA |
| 背面描述 | Central shield-shaped coat of arms of Italian Somaliland, featuring a lion passant above horizontal stripes and two stars at the base, surmounted by a mural crown with battlements. Flanking olive or laurel branches extend from the shield's base. The denomination 'L 10' appears to the lower left and right of the arms, and the date '1925' is inscribed in the exergue. The legend 'SOMALIA ITALIANA' arcs around the upper periphery. |

| 附加信息 |
The 1925 Italian 10 Lire proof strikes occupy a peculiar administrative moment — Mussolini had consolidated dictatorial power earlier that year following the Matteotti crisis, and the mint was already beginning to reorient its prestige productions toward Fascist iconographic priorities. Prova pieces from this transitional window were struck in extremely limited numbers for official approval, not public release, making survivorship a function of archival luck rather than collector demand.
KM#Pr13 is documented but population data remains thin across major grading services.
